5 Foods Every Woman Must Eat for a Healthy Uterus Diet

A woman’s uterine health is of utmost importance. The uterus plays an essential role in a woman’s reproductive system, and any complications can lead to severe consequences. The good news is that a proper diet can help maintain a healthy uterus. Here are five foods that every woman must include in her diet for a healthy uterus.

1. Leafy Green Vegetables

Spinach, kale, broccoli, and other leafy green vegetables are high in essential vitamins and minerals like iron, folates, and calcium that are vital for a healthy uterus. These foods help regulate menstrual cycles, prevent hormone imbalances, and reduce the risk of uterine fibroids. Incorporating a variety of green vegetables in your diet can provide a wide range of nutrients that are essential for uterine health.

2. Fruits

Fruits are a great source of essential v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ants needed for a healthy uterus. Berries, citrus fruits, pineapples, and bananas contain essential nutrients like Vitamin C and potassium that help to regulate hormone levels, reduce inflammation, and prevent infections. Eating fruits can also help prevent heavy periods, reduce cramps and lower the risk of uterine cancer.

3. Whole Grains

Whole grains contain essential nutrients such as fiber, magnesium, and Vitamin B that are essential for a healthy uterus. Foods such as brown rice, oats, quinoa, and whole wheat bread provide the body with a steady stream of energy, reduce inflammation, and regulate hormone levels. Whole grains can also help reduce the risk of ovarian and uterine cancer.

4. Probiotic-rich foods

Probiotics are essential for gut and vaginal health. Fermented foods such as yogurt, kefir, kimchi, and sauerkraut contain essential bacteria that help maintain a healthy vaginal and gut microbiome. These foods can help prevent and treat bacterial vaginosis, a common vaginal infection that can lead to uterine infections and complications. Probiotics can also help reduce inflammation, improve digestion, and boost the immune system.

5. Nuts and Seeds

Nuts and seeds contain essential nutrients such as zinc and Vitamin E that are crucial for uterine health. Almonds, walnuts, chia seeds, flax seeds, and sunflower seeds are high in antioxidants and essential fatty acids that help reduce inflammation and regulate hormone levels. These foods can help improve blood flow to the uterus, prevent fibroids, and reduce the risk of ovarian, endometrial, and cervical cancer.

In conclusion, a healthy uterus requires a well-balanced diet that includes essential nutrients and antioxidants. Including these five foods in your diet can help maintain a healthy uterus, regulate menstrual cycles, prevent hormone imbalances, and reduce the risk of infections and cancer. A healthy lifestyle that includes regular exercise, stress management, and hydration can also contribute to uterine health. It’s essential to consult with your healthcare provider if you have any concerns about your uterine health.
